Output 40d84c6e739cf5ece9a59aa04a1129d534bd5669de701d6d3ca597fe1af000d8:0

value
31361181
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66a0db60232a28ef7a4d68251c9e996f0ea677da OP_EQUAL
address
3B3fYeSMqwrynfH7CHw1owku7tVdDLftsr
transaction
40d84c6e739cf5ece9a59aa04a1129d534bd5669de701d6d3ca597fe1af000d8
spent
true